Factory]<\/p>\n<p>The press material for this release\u2014the first in NPR\u2019s Discover Songs series\u2014reference by first-name-only the divas who came before: Ella, Sarah, Dinah, Nina, Billie, Anita. The implication, one supposes, is that some day you will also come to know Madeleine, Esperanza, Eliane, Tierney and Melody in the same way. Whether those contemporary women (surnames: Peyroux, Spalding, Elias, Sutton and Gardot) will ever command that level of instant recognition remains to be seen, but all of them\u2014and nine more\u2014demonstrate here how they\u2019ve each carved out a formidable place in today\u2019s jazz world. Brazil\u2019s Elias brings a near-gospel fervor to her take on Bob Marley\u2019s \u201cJammin\u2019,\u201d while Jane Monheit\u2019s orchestral \u201cOver the Rainbow\u201d is minimal and ethereal. Sutton experiments with time and space on \u201cHappy Days Are Here Again\u201d and Diana Krall\u2019s interpretation of Tom Waits\u2019 \u201cTemptation\u201d is slinky and cool. \u2013 Jeff Tamarkin<\/p>\n<div><strong><br \/>\n<\/strong><\/div>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>VARIOUS ARTISTS The New Jazz Divas [Shout!
